Mrs. Jack-Rich did not sleep with Seyi Tinubu for ministerial slot – Family refutes sexual allegation

The Jack-Rich family has responded to reports that claimed Elizabeth Jack-Rich, the wife of Oil magnet, Tein Jack-Rich, a past aspirant for president under the All Progressives Congress, had a sexual relationship with Seyi Tinubu, the son of President Bola Tinubu.

Reports by online media platforms had claimed that Jack-Rich had paid N500m to lobby for a ministerial position in Tinubu’s cabinet while simultaneously allowing his wife to have sex with Seyi Tinubu in that capacity.

The family said in a letter signed by High Chief I.J. Ibiwari, which was made available to The PUNCH on Sunday, that the reports were nothing more than a sponsored article by political scallywags intended to tarnish the image of “Mrs. Jack-Rich and her innocent children.”

He wrote:

”With honour, we appreciate your understanding, and for detesting the avalanche of the most injuriously preposterous insult melted on the family by political scallywags.

These individuals, with no employable skills outside political office other than blackmail, have decided to form a coalition of political hostage takers at home and overseas to pursue their 2027 interests.

”This is the climax of political desperation by desperadoes who want to forcefully enter a house they fought against. Their vice style is attack to enter. Now they want to come inside the house by attacking those who are the builders of the house they once fought.

”Nigerians are watching with keenness what will become of this melancholy. Dr. Elizabeth is a well-groomed Yoruba mother who understands matrimony. She is brave, intelligent, beautiful, and an asset anyone cannot object to acquiring. A beautiful mother to many countless families in her care.”

The family additionally advised the public in the statement not to believe acts of slander against Elizabeth.

”The public should now be aware that because these interlopers and their cohorts are weaklings with no value to deliver any public economic good; their only means to power is to launch blackmail on critical intellectual assets, including the likes of Dr. Elizabeth.”

The family therefore, expressed its unflinching support for Mrs Jack-Rich in the face of any type of attack or provocation.

”Dear Dr. Elizabeth, your husband, and Nigerians stand with you. In the face of this provocative, baseless, malicious, harmful, and most preposterous allegation with a devilish imprint.”
